PFUHL– Phyllis I., 95, Fort Myers, FL, formerly of Johnstown, went to be with the Lord on June 6, 2025. Born on October 30, 1929, in Philadelphia, PA, daughter of Henry and Bernadine Meyer. Preceded in death by her parents; husband, Herbert Pfuhl Jr.; brother-in-law, Paul Pfuhl; daughter,Barbara Regula (wife of James J. Regula), sister, Jeanne Suarez. Survived by her loving children, Debra, wife of J. Mark Schoming, Greensburg, PA, Herbert, III, married to the former Glenda (Warfel), Halifax, PA, Paula, wife of Michael Urban, Estero, FL and Dawna, wife of Terry Benner, Fort Myers, FL. Also survived by grandchildren, Jacquelyn, Ryan, Lori, Jessica, Megan, Herb, Errick, Kaitlin, Allison, Ashley, Carrie, Jason, Danielle, Heather, Eric and Camryn; great-grandchildren, Alexis, Michael, Olivia, Matthew, Taylor, Emerson and Brevyn; sister-in-law, Mary Pfuhl, Johnstown, PA, sister-in-law, Eleanor Shumaker, Arvada, CO, and five nieces. Phyllis was a 1946 graduate of Johnstown High School. She was a member of Bethany Presbyterian Church. Phyllis was a local Registrar in Johnstown for 20 years. She was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, great-grandmother, sister and loyal friend who will be sadly missed.
